Oakland resident who died in head-on crash on Byron Highway is identified
The crash happened Dec. 30 near Clifton Court, the California Highway Patrol said.
Authorities have identified a woman who died in a head-on collision on the Byron Highway in East Contra Costa County last month.
The crash Dec. 30 on the highway near Clifton Court killed 29-year-old Antoinette Thompson-Scott, of Oakland. The Contra Costa County Coroner’s Office released her identity.
According to the California Highway Patrol, a white Chevrolet Silverado crossed into oncoming traffic while traveling northbound and crashed into a grey Kia sedan.
Thompson-Scott was driving the sedan. Police said she was not seat-belted.
The two occupants of the Chevrolet were injured and taken to a trauma center in Walnut Creek. One went by helicopter. The CHP has not provided updates on their conditions.
A Hyundai Elantra going south on Byron Highway and a Hummer going north hit debris created by the crash but were uninjured despite damage to their vehicles, the CHP said.
Alcohol and drugs are not believed to be a factor in the wreck.
